What is Teen Patti?

Teen patti (three cards) is a three-card vying game derived from the classic British game of three-card brag. Players receive three cards, place bets during one or more rounds, and the highest-ranking hand at showdown wins the pot. The flavor of play ranges from relaxed social tables, where bluffing and banter dominate, to high-stakes competitive rooms and tournaments with structured blind formats.

How a typical hand plays out

A typical social game runs like this: each player puts an ante or contributes to the blind. Players receive three cards. Those who want to see their cards are called “chaal” players, and those who don’t remain “blind.” Betting proceeds clockwise. Players either call, raise (increase the bet), or fold. If two players want a side-show, the intervening players must agree and the two compare cards privately; the lower hand folds. The game ends when everyone except one player folds, or when a show is called and hands are compared.

Practical strategy: position, hand selection, and psychology

Strategy in Teen patti blends probability, bankroll management, and reading opponents. Here are practical, experience-driven principles that work across social and online play.

1. Start with disciplined hand selection

In early sessions, tighten your range. Play aggressively with top-tier hands (trails, pure sequences, strong pairs) and fold weak high-card hands unless you are in a prime position to bluff. My recommendation: treat pair and above as a value zone; high cards with no pair should be used for position-based bluffs, not as anchors for big pots.

2. Use position to your advantage

Being last to act is powerful. You get free information—who checked, who raised, who folded—before making a decision. If you’re late to act and the pot is small, you can bluff more often. If the pot is large and multiple active players remain, tighten up and favor showdown-worthy hands.

3. Bet sizing and pot control

Adjust bet sizes based on pot size, the table dynamic, and perceived opponent tendencies. Small, frequent bets can extract value from timid players; large, decisive bets punish calling stations and protect your hand against draws. One habit I learned at a lively weekend game: vary bet sizes purposefully so attentive opponents can’t map your actions to exact holdings.

4. Bluff intelligently

Bluffing is situational. Bluff against single, cautious opponents more than against loose, sticky players who call often. A successful bluff relies on consistent story-telling: your wagers should match what a strong hand would do in that situation. Random bluffs fail more often than well-timed ones.

5. Pay attention to player types

Classify opponents: tight, loose, aggressive, passive. A tight-aggressive player is dangerous; avoid multi-way pots with them unless you’re strong. Against loose-passive players, value-bet thin margins—they’ll call with worse hands. Observing patterns for 10–20 hands is enough to form a baseline impression.

Bankroll and table selection

Your bankroll dictates appropriate stakes. Standard guideline: never risk more than a small percentage of your bankroll in a single session; this prevents tilt and long-term ruin. Table selection matters: choose tables where you have a skill edge—players who over-bluff, mis-manage bets, or routinely ignore position. In my experience, moving down in stakes to practice strategies results in better long-term gains than stubbornly playing higher stakes while learning.

Reading tells and table psychology

In live play physical tells matter: hesitations, eye contact, chip movements. Online, timing, bet patterns, and chat behavior are your tells. One personal anecdote: at a holiday gathering, a friend habitually tapped the table before bluffing. After spotting that cue, the group’s win-rate improved noticeably. The takeaway: small patterns compound—note them, test them, exploit them sparingly so opponents don’t adapt.

FAQ

Is Teen patti skill or luck?

Both. Luck determines the immediate cards, but skill dictates which pots you contest, bet sizing, and opponent exploitation. Over many hands, disciplined players can convert small edges into consistent wins.

Are online Teen patti games fair?

Reputable sites use certified RNGs and publish fairness reports. Always check licensing and community feedback. Test by playing low-stakes or free modes before depositing significant funds.

Can I make money playing Teen patti?

Some players consistently profit, especially in lower-to-mid stakes where skill gaps are larger. Success requires bankroll management, emotional control, and adapting strategy to table conditions.
